How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Memphis?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Memphis Studio Apartments | $1,028 | $200 | $1,888 |
| Memphis 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,157 | $485 | $2,880 |
| Memphis 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,301 | $595 | $5,900 |
| Memphis 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,677 | $675 | $5,940 |
| Memphis 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,536 | $599 | $5,877 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Memphis Apartments
What is a cheap apartment in Memphis?
A cheap apartment is any apartment up to the 30% percentile of cost for the area, which in Memphis is under $618.
What is the price of a cheap apartment in Memphis?
The cheapest apartment in Memphis is Coronado Manor which is listed at $500, while the average apartment in Memphis costs $2,300.
What types of apartments are the cheapest in Memphis?
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 5,031 regular apartments in Memphis that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.
How do the prices of cheap apartments compare to the average apartment in Memphis?
Cheap apartments in Memphis have an average cost of $567 which is $1,733 cheaper than the average rent for all rentals in Memphis.
